Subject: My secret question answer.
   I am trying to remember the answer to my secret question, to get to the parental controls section thing, just to see what it's about. I'm pretty sure of what the answer is, but am not completely sure. So, my question is this: Say I try to access this page several times, but fail to enter the correct password. Will Blizz see this, and lock my account thinking that it is somehow compromised? Because, that would blow. Thanks for any help.
Standard procedure dictates "no."

Subject: Re: My secret question answer.
   While I do not believe that any harm may come to you if you merely attempt to "guess" the answer to your Secret Question in such a manner, Credwindge, I believe you may find the official avenues more fruitful; if I were you, I would call Billing at 1-800-59-BLIZZ between the hours of 9 a.m. and 6 p.m. Pacific time, Monday through Friday, so that our representatives may offer further assistance. You can also, if you prefer, fill out the following form and either fax or mail it to us. In any case, friend, best of luck to you. :)
